While directors saw their remuneration rise by 6.9% in 2013, middle managers suffered a fall of 3.8% and workers a drop of 0.4%. The figures, based on 80,000 interviews, show that the average salary of directors has been on the rise in spite of the crisis, with the exception of 2009.
